Quote from: oldspice
Quote from: Cherry_Ripe

I would rescue an ex-racing greyhound (or two).



My daughter has a part-time job looking after racing greyhounds and she is a qualified dog-handler. She helps to 'home' retired racing greyhounds and assures me they make the most wonderful pets.



I couldn't agree more. My friend has 3 greyhounds all from Greyhound Rescue Scotland and they are just the most amazing pets to have. Some greyhounds are a bit problematic at first due to being badly treated or to the fact that some have never even seen stairs of a washing machine before, but with perseverence and a lot of love they give the same back in abundance. If I had a little more time in my life my house would be filled with these beautiful animals. Oldspice, I take my hat off to your daughter.
